Hand held massage ball
Description
FIG. 1 is a side elevation view of a hand held massage ball showing my new design, with all other sides being identical to that shown;
FIG. 2 is top plan view thereof;
FIG. 3 is a bottom plan thereof;
FIG. 4 is a perspective view thereof;
FIG. 5 is a side elevation view of a second embodiment of the hand held massage ball showing my new design, with all other sides being the same, the only difference residing in the bottom portion;
FIG. 6 is top plan view thereof;
FIG. 7 is a bottom plan thereof; and,
FIG. 8 is a perspective view thereof.
